208 
209 /*
210  * We solve this problem by top sort,but we need to update the adjacent
211  * vertex earliest value at decreasing the adjacent vertex in-degree,the
212  * earliest the max value of parent's earliest value add the weight(last time).
213  * The vertex which has no in-degree will set earliest to 0 at first time
214  *
215  * Top sort algorithms thoughts:
216  * 1.we first initialize all vertex in-degree is zero,then we according to
217  * the graph to set the each vertex in-degree.
218  * 2.find zero in-degree vertex and put it in queue.
219  * 3.get a vertex from a queue and record its index
220  * 4.get the all adjacent vertex of the vertex and let them in-degree decrement,at this moment,if
221  * some vertex has decrease into zero,we put them into queue.
222  * 5.Execute this operation until the queue is empty
223  *
224  * @param grap A graph which use adjacent list is used to store the vertex
225  * @param topOrder A <code>vertex</code> array to store the index of the
226  *             vertex about the top queue
227  * @return If the graph is no circle,indicate the top sort is correct 1 will be return
228  * otherwise will return 0
229  */
230 int getEarliestDate(adjacentTableGraph graph, vertex topOrder[]) {
231     vertex v;
232     ptrToAdjNode w;
233     int indegree[MAX_VERTEX_NUM], vertexConter = 0;
234     /*
235      * Create a queue to store the vertex whose in-degree is zero
236      */
237     pQueue queue = createEmptyQueue();
238     /*
239      * Initialize topOrder
240      */
241     for (v = 0; v < graph->vertex_number; v++) {
242         indegree[v] = 0;
243     }
244     for (v = 0; v < graph->vertex_number; v++) {
245         for (w = graph->g[v].head; w; w = w->next) {
246             indegree[w->adjVerx]++;
247         }
248     }
249 
250     /*
251      * Add in-degree vertex to queue
252      */
253     for (v = 0; v < graph->vertex_number; v++) {
254         if (indegree[v] == 0) {
255             addQueue(queue, v);
256             graph->g[v].earliest = 0;
257         }
258     }
259     while (!isQueueEmpty(queue)) {
260         v = deleteEleFromQueue(queue);
261         /*
262          * Record the vertex of top sort
263          */
264         topOrder[vertexConter++] = v;
265         for (w = graph->g[v].head; w; w = w->next) {
266             if ((graph->g[v].earliest + w->weight)
267                     > (graph->g[w->adjVerx].earliest)) {
268                 graph->g[w->adjVerx].earliest = graph->g[v].earliest
269                         + w->weight;
270             }
271             if (--indegree[w->adjVerx] == 0) {
272                 addQueue(queue, w->adjVerx);
273             }
274         }
275     }
276 
277     /*
278      *Adjust whether all vertexes have been recorded
279      */
280     if (vertexConter == graph->vertex_number) {
281         return 1;
282     } else {
283         return 0;
284     }
285 }

314 
315 /*
316  * Calculate the the latest by the earliest and the top sort result
317  * From the class,we can know the latest value is minimal value amount the child vertex's latest
318  * minus the weight(we use the weight as the lasting time).Before caller this method,we have
319  * initialize the terminal vertex latest value.You can see the method above.
320  *@param grap A graph which use adjacent list is used to store the vertex
321  *@param topOrder a <code>vertex</code> array to store the top sort result
322  *
323  */
324 void calculateTheLatest(adjacentTableGraph graph, vertex topOrder[]) {
325     int length = graph->vertex_number, i;
326     ptrToAdjNode w;
327     vertex v;
328     for (i = length -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
329         for (v = 0; v < graph->vertex_number; v++) {
330             for (w = graph->g[v].head; w; w = w->next) {
331                 if (w->adjVerx == topOrder[i]) {
332                     if (graph->g[v].latest
333                             > (graph->g[topOrder[i]].latest - w->weight)) {
334                         graph->g[v].latest = graph->g[topOrder[i]].latest
335                                 - w->weight;
336                     }
337 
338                 }
339             }
340         }
341     }
342 }
343 
344 /*
345  * Print the key path,we know when child vertex's latest minus parent vertex's earliest
346  * and minus the weight(we use the weight as the lasting time),if the result is  equal zero
347  * indicating this is key path.we print them.
348  *@param grap A graph which use adjacent list is used to store the vertex
349  */
350 void recordKeyActivity(adjacentTableGraph graph) {
351     vertex v;
352     ptrToAdjNode w;
353     for (v = 0; v < graph->vertex_number; v++) {
354         for (w = graph->g[v].head; w; w = w->next) {
355             if (graph->g[w->adjVerx].latest - graph->g[v].earliest
356                     == w->weight) {
357                 printf("%d->%d
", v + 1, w->adjVerx + 1);
358             }
359         }
360     }
361 }
